In a dream journal I find notes to make a film, but there is nothing concrete about the dream that generated them. Just a mix of fascination and concern. I decide to retrace my steps and start at the place where I grew up: the Faculty of Architecture and Natural Sciences of the University of Buenos Aires. The history of sciences and cities is founded on a structure of power and bureaucratic violence, and at the same time, these institutions are inhabited by sensitive scientists who wonder about other ways of cohabiting the world. In the contradiction, I become a witness to the unexpected: birds dreaming synthetic melodies, a parrot singing songs about animals, a monkey howling in response to the roar of engines. How do these institutions see and hear? How is knowledge about nature represented over time?
